Frequently Asked Questions

Can I add a smart gate to my pool fence for convenience?

Yes, but integration must meet strict safety codes. While the smart gate trend is low locally, any automated latch on a pool barrier must comply with IRC Appendix AG of the 2024 Ohio Residential Code. The system must be a self-closing, self-latching device with manual override. We specify IoT components that log access attempts, which can help manage liability for Ohio homeowners.

What fencing material holds up best to local soil and pests?

Material compatibility is dictated by the moderate soil corrosivity index and moderate termite risk level. Pressure-treated Southern Yellow Pine is a standard, but posts require proper ground-contact treatment ratings. For metal posts and fasteners, we specify hot-dip galvanized steel to prevent rust streaks. Avoid standard steel posts, as they will corrode prematurely in this environment.

What are the height and placement rules for a fence on my property?

Mingo Junction zoning enforces a 4-foot height limit in front yards and a 6-foot limit in rear yards. The 0-foot setback regulation allows building directly on the property line. For corner lots, especially those near the high-traffic OH-7 corridor, you must maintain a clear 'sight triangle' at intersections. This is a critical safety zone where no visual obstruction over 3 feet high is permitted.

What is required before you can dig the first post hole?

The Ohio Utilities Protection Service (OUPS) 811 locate is non-negotiable. Hitting a gas, water, or fiber line in Downtown Mingo Junction creates major liability, service disruption, and repair costs. We manage the entire process: filing the OUPS ticket, coordinating the 48-hour wait, and pulling any necessary permit from the Mingo Junction Municipal Building permit office before mobilization.

Am I legally required to notify my neighbor before building a fence?

Yes. Ohio Revised Code Section 971.01, the 'Good Neighbor Fence Law,' specifically requires written notice to adjoining landowners when replacing a shared boundary fence. In Mingo Junction, this 2026 legal requirement includes a 30-day notice period. Failure to provide notice can result in cost-sharing disputes and legal complications.

Is a standard fence strong enough for our high winds?

No. The 115 MPH V-ult wind speed rating requires specific engineering. This 'ultimate design wind speed' dictates post spacing, concrete footing mass, and bracket strength. A fence built to generic big-box store specs will fail. We calculate loads per ASCE 7-22 standards, often using 4x4 posts on 6-foot centers with hurricane ties to survive peak storm season gusts channeled down the Ohio Valley.

Why do post footings need to be so deep in Mingo Junction?

The local 32-inch frost line depth is the governing factor. Posts set above this depth are subject to frost heave, which will shift the footing and rack the entire fence structure. In Downtown Mingo Junction, soil moisture from the Ohio River valley exacerbates this. We design all footings to IRC standards, setting posts a minimum of 36 inches deep to prevent structural failure.
